Complexity and challenge
Selling flooring online means selling a project decision, not just a product.
Flooring is a particularly complex product to sell online because it requires a high level of visualization, technical understanding, and validation before purchase. Unlike a simpler e-commerce product, users often need to imagine how it will look in their space, compare finishes, understand use cases, calculate the required surface area, anticipate installation constraints, and sometimes validate their choice with an expert. The site therefore had to make an abstract product feel more concrete, while avoiding overwhelming the experience with too much technical information too early in the journey.
The complexity also came from Flordeco’s commercial structure. Its network of franchised merchants involves multiple local realities, variable services, and an important relationship between the transactional website and physical stores. On top of that, the platform had to support two distinct conversion paths: some products could be purchased directly online, while others required a quote request with a surface area calculation. The challenge was therefore to design an experience where direct purchase, quote requests, expert support, and complementary services could coexist without creating confusion in the user journey.
Approach
Start from users’ needs, language, and intent rather than the company’s internal logic.
Our approach combined UX strategy, CRO logic, and e-commerce thinking to reposition the website as a decision-support tool. The first step was to rethink the full information architecture, moving away from a structure based on the company’s internal logic toward one built around real user intent. In a context like Flordeco’s, the way a company categorizes its products does not always match the way customers search, compare, or express their needs.
We therefore analyzed the different navigation scenarios: exploring by flooring type, shopping by room or project, understanding services, finding a merchant, comparing options, purchasing directly, or requesting a quote. This reading of the user journeys allowed us to prioritize information based on its role in the decision-making process: guiding, reassuring, educating, filtering, comparing, converting, or directing users toward support. The goal was to create an experience that does not rely solely on the user’s prior knowledge, but helps them move forward even when they do not yet master the product vocabulary.
Solution
Create a Shopify platform that simplifies complexity without diminishing the richness of the offer.
The digital solution was designed as a guided e-commerce platform, capable of supporting the richness of Flordeco’s offer without turning the experience into a difficult-to-navigate catalogue. Rather than reducing complexity by removing information, we focused on sequencing it more effectively: presenting the right elements at the right time, based on the user’s level of engagement and understanding.
The homepage was rethought as a strategic orientation point. For a website like Flordeco’s, the homepage cannot simply introduce the brand or promote products. It needs to quickly help users understand where to start, especially when their needs are still unclear. The structure therefore highlights the main journey entry points: shopping products, discovering flooring types, exploring services, finding a merchant, or getting support for a project.
The new navigation also helps clarify the relationship between the website and the physical store network. It makes the paths to purchase, quote requests, services, and contact points more visible, while reducing the cognitive effort required to find one’s way. The goal was to create a clearer, more useful, and more action-oriented first impression, allowing users to quickly identify the path that matches their level of readiness.
